Why It's Not Healthy to Deal with Work-Related Stress
Most people who work deal with some type of stress from time to time. It's normal to have some days a little more stressful than others, but some people have incredibly stressful jobs that take the joy and excitement out of life. You might dread getting up in the morning just because you have to work. You might find that your job is causing enough stress in your life where you are sick all the time, exhausted and just generally feel badly about yourself. Many people who have issues with stress at work also tend to have low self-esteem because of the fact that they feel they are not doing a very good job.
The reason it's so unhealthy to deal with this type of stress is because it can put a true damper on your overall health and well-being. You may find that you get sick more easily because of stress, or you might deal with weight gain and other issues that could directly affect your health in a negative way.
